APT Countryside Management have been providing Woodland Management Services since 1991.
Specialising in woodland investments up to 200ha in size, upon purchase we provide a range of services tailored to the client’s immediate requirements. These include developing the woodlands inherent value, utilising the woodlands as a source of sustainable / renewable energy and the sporting and conservation interests of the holding.
Through our effective Woodland Planning strategies we work with our clients to improve the infrastructure of the woodland and increase the long-term value of the investment through either one of, or a mix of:
• Developing the potential for commercial timber – planning the transition, growth and management of woodlands generally in excess of 50ha,
• Developing the sporting value – approximately 60% of all woodland in the UK has a sporting association,
• Improving the amenity value of woodland – developing the structure and potential of the woodland,
• Developing the conservation aspects of the woodland and habitat protection.
We have a track record of obtaining commercial grants to improve the estate and can help the client realise some of the tax and inheritance benefits associated with woodland investments.
